Plywood Subfloor Repair in Conroe, TX
Plywood subfloor repair services address issues related to damaged or compromised subflooring beneath a home's finished flooring. This service is commonly requested for projects involving water damage, wood rot, or structural concerns that affect the stability and safety of the floor. Property owners often seek this repair to restore a solid foundation for new flooring installations or to prevent further deterioration that could lead to more extensive and costly repairs.
Homeowners should understand that plywood subfloor repair involves replacing or reinforcing sections of the subfloor to ensure proper support and levelness. Before requesting this service, it’s helpful to identify the extent of damage, whether it’s localized or widespread, and to consider the underlying causes such as leaks or moisture issues. Proper assessment can help determine the best approach to restore the subfloor’s integrity and prepare the space for continued use or renovation.

Plywood Subfloor Repair Questions
What causes plywood subfloor damage? Common causes include moisture exposure, improper installation, and structural shifts that lead to warping or rotting.
How can I tell if my subfloor needs repair? Signs include squeaking floors, uneven surfaces, or visible sagging and damage in the plywood.
What types of repairs are typically performed on plywood subfloors? Repairs often involve replacing damaged sections, reinforcing weak areas, and ensuring a level surface for flooring installation.
Is repair necessary before installing new flooring? Yes, a stable and even subfloor is essential for proper installation and long-term durability of new flooring.
